Mr. Chairman, I come down here every year on this type of amendment. When I came to Congress 14 years ago, I went to Afghanistan and I went to Iraq. I visited with our troops. Since that time, I have on my wall 40 Americans of all races and most branches who have been killed in Afghanistan or Iraq. When I was there in Afghanistan, I was down on the border with our troops and the British troops. They are on the border to protect Afghanistan from the terrorists coming in from Pakistan. I don't understand why we continue to pay Pakistan money. This legislation doesn't cut the whole fund. It cuts $200 million of the $700 million fund to get the attention of the Pakistanis so that they can't keep playing it. I am sure the Pakistanis are glad that I am leaving Congress. I won't be back here next year to offer this amendment. But really, I have great respect for the chairwoman and the ranking member on this issue, but I think that we should not pay Pakistan to continue to hate us because they will do it for free. I think we should do it to protect our troops that are on the border of Afghanistan and Pakistan. And that is just the way it is. Mr. Chair, I yield back the balance of my time.
